PROJECT OVERVIEW

Henry Point Development (HPD), a Pacific Northwest development firm, is re-energizing the iconic 1938 building in the heart of Milwaukie, Oregon; located at 10722 SE Main Street, Milwaukie, OR 97222. Since being constructed nearly a century ago, the WPA project has housed many functions, including serving as Milwaukie City Hall, the Fire Department, library, court services, and even as a dance hall. With careful historic preservation, retrofitting and new amenities, the space will now become home to a hip brewery restaurant, locally owned coffee house, sizable community meeting room, and multiple executive suites. The facilities will offer 18-hour activation for public uses from hospitality services to community engagement both indoors and out.

 

To ensure the character of being one of the city’s cherished gathering hubs is celebrated, HDP is working with Raziah Roushan, Inc. (RRI), a local public arts coordinator to facilitate the Call for Artists and carry the art installation portion of the project to completion (estimated April 2025). In addition to an existing outdoor sculpture garden, HPD has identified four (4) new public art zones, both indoor and outdoor. The new public art scope, review and determinations are being designed by an 8-person Steering Committee composed of Milwaukie residents and business representatives. This is intended to ensure a deeper connection and representation of the new artwork to the many community members who frequent these space(s).
